Box 66 Orono, MN 55356 Crystal Bay, MN 55323-0066 To Current Owner: Address: el"10 old 1-6,\, LodCc. d City Ordinance 199 requires that each existing on-site sewage treatment system in Orono be inspected every two years. The on-site sewage treatment system at the above address has been inspected and appears to fall into the categories checked below. �S�YSTEM CONFORMITY (1-3): I 0(1 ) "CODE SYSTEM" An ISTS which meets all the location,design and construction standards of the current Orono Municipal Code. 2 "COMPLIANT SYSTEM" An ISTS which does not meet all the location,design and construction standards of the current Orono Municipal Code but does meet the three foot separation requirement or two foot requirement for systems installed 1996 or earlier,and which is not failing or an imminent threat to public health or safety. 3 "NON-COMPLIANT SYSTEM" A prohibited ISTS;an ISTS located within a designated 100-year flood plain,any ISTS which may or may not meet all the location,design,or construction standards of the current Orono Municipal Code and which is failing for any reason;and any ISTS with less than three feet of unsaturated soil or sand between the distribution device and the limiting soil characteristics. TANK CONDITION(5-7): C. Tank inspection indicates: Pumpout not needed at this time. 6 Septic tanks must be pumped out this year (city code recommends tanks to be pumped out once every 3 years. Tank was last pumped Sr-12,-0Z- ). Make sure septic tanks are pumped through manhole and not through white inspection pipes. This allows for the proper cleaning. Keep water softner and iron filter discharge out of septic system to prolonglife of drainfield. Ask pumper to test alarm float to verify alarm is still working in your house. The alarm warns owner that septage is about to backup into basement. 7 Inspection risers missing-tanks could not be inspected. Inspection risers(4"dia.pipe)must be installed in each tank. If tanks have not been pumped out within the last three years,they should be pumped out now. DRAINFIELD CONDITION(8-10): Drainfield is dry,no surfacing evident. 9 Some evidence of surfacing,not critical yet. 10 Drainfield is saturated and visibly discharging untreated effluent to the surface.
